Short and without legal fog: what happens to the data you send through the contact form, and what the site analytics collects.

What data is collected

Through the contact form I receive only what you typed yourself:

  • the name you gave;
  • an email address for the reply;
  • the text of your message.

Legal basis

Processing rests on your consent, given by ticking the checkbox under the form. You can withdraw it at any time by emailing the address below.

Purpose of processing

The data is used to reply to your enquiry. If your task goes beyond what I can do personally, the enquiry may be passed to OTAKOYI, the company where I work as CTO, so that a team can be offered to you. That handover is manual and only when needed; there is no automatic sync.

Storage

The site has no database of its own. Your enquiry exists as an email in my working inbox and is retained for no longer than one month, after which it is deleted. It is not written to a database, logs, or a CRM. Server logs keep only an error code, timestamp, and page locale: no name, email, message text, or IP address.

Email delivery — Resend

The email carrying your enquiry is delivered by Resend, which acts as a data processor. Your data passes through it in transit so the message reaches my inbox.

Analytics — Plausible

Visit statistics are collected by Plausible without cookies, personal data, or cross-site tracking. I can see which pages are read and where visitors came from, but not who they are. The site's only cookie is NEXT_LOCALE, which remembers your chosen language; it is strictly functional and needs no consent.

Deletion and requests

Email hello@maluk.tech and I will delete the message carrying your enquiry from the mailbox I control and confirm it in my reply. This removes the copy I retain; technical retention within Resend's systems is governed by that processor's policy.
